ABOUT THE BOOK

 If you’re drowning in the weeds of motherhood, Cindy Caprio Woulfe feels your plight.


As a new mom, Woulfe felt the same pressures and pleasures as mothers across the globe. Unlike many others, she decided to create a solution—or at least a mother’s helper.


  In the Weeds is her heartfelt guide for women navigating the overwhelming early years of motherhood. Using personal stories and practical wisdom to share a journey of finding peace as a new parent, Woulfe includes thoughtful journal prompts for moms designed to encourage reflection and growth during this transformative time.    

 Through engaging anecdotes, Woulfe provides essential strategies on how to practice self-care as a parent without guilt, establish healthy boundaries and reconnect with your identity beyond motherhood. Addressing both mental and emotional wellbeing, 

In the Weeds offers a 30-day framework to help you weather the challenges while embracing the joys of parenthood.    


  Woulfe understands that while you want to help your children, you need to nurture yourself first. Through Woulfe’s authentic guidance, you’ll discover that the path through the weeds begins with self-compassion and leads to deeper connections for your entire family.  

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

 Cindy Caprio Woulfe is a full time mother, a certified meditation teacher and wellness advocate residing in Connecticut with her husband and two sons. A University of Colorado at Boulder graduate in Communication and  an Institute of Integrative Nutrition alumna, she balances motherhood with her passion for mindfulness practices.


Through her writing, she offers compassionate guidance for mothers seeking balance amid life's overwhelming moments. She is a regular contributor to Fairfield County Mom. In the Weeds is her first book.
